Hello,
you can put the group of actions inside a route block and then execute
that route block from failure_route and other locations in your config.

On 05.05.22 19:50, David Villasmil wrote:
> Hello guys,
>
> Is it possible to call a failure_route like a normal route?
>
> i.e.:
>
> {
> t_on_failure("myroute");
> }
> ...
>
> route("myroute");
>
> failure_route[myroute] {
> ...
> }
>
> Let me explain:
>
> I have this scenario where a DNS name may get deleted and a dns
> resolution will fail. There's no pinging to that gateway so i need to:
>
> - skip that gateway when dispatching to the setid
> - detect whether the domain is up and available
>
> And failover to the next gateway.
>
> I don't know of any other way so on the DISPATCH route, I'm doing:
>
> route[DISPATCH] {
> # round robin dispatching on gateways group '1'
> if(!ds_select_dst("1", "4")) {
> send_reply("404", "No destination");
> exit;
> }
> xlog("L_DBG", "--- SCRIPT: going to <$ru> via <$du>\n");
> if(dns_query("$du", "xyz")) {
> t_on_failure("RTF_DISPATCH");
> route(RELAY);
> } else {
> route(RTF_DISPATCH);
> }
> exit;
> }
>
> to try to resolve and if it fails, it will just go to the failover route.
>
>
> makes sense?
